Skip to content

Check EOF after TDataSet.Next to prevent double-handling of last record#6

Open
kevind7 wants to merge 1 commit intomarcocantu:masterfrom
kevind7:LoopDatasetEOFHandling
Open

Check EOF after TDataSet.Next to prevent double-handling of last record#6
kevind7 wants to merge 1 commit intomarcocantu:masterfrom
kevind7:LoopDatasetEOFHandling

Conversation

@kevind7
Copy link

@kevind7 kevind7 commented Jun 20, 2018

The check for EOF has been modified so it is called directly after the call to Next. Previously, the ForEach loop was accessing the last record in a dataset twice.
Extra unit tests have been added to cover ForEach with datasets.

Thanks

Kevin Dean

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ant

Comments